About The Position

Provide technical engineering support to Navy and Lockheed Martin customers for issues related to D5 Missile processing for the Fleet Ballistic Missile (FBM) Program. Candidate will provide liaison between LM and its customers to ensure conformance to quality and technical requirements. Individual will be expected to develop solutions to technical problems of varying complexity, perform in a team environment and work under the general direction of a group lead. Individual directly supports activities involving the handling, assembly, disassembly, testing and repair of missile, ordnance hardware and supporting equipment. Candidate will provide technical guidance and solutions within, but not limited to the following areas: 1) Isolation and correction of anomalous/nonconforming missile hardware and support equipment 2) Development of test/troubleshooting plans for addressing missile package, component and systems test issues 3) Determination of compliance to and corrections of missile/missile-system processing and requirements documentation 4) Various special engineering studies. Candidate provides technical guidance for maintenance, operation and repair of missile acceptance testing related support equipment. Position does not include development of new hardware designs however requires an ability to understand electrical schematics and equipment design/functionality for troubleshooting. Candidate should have an understanding and ability to apply basic Electrical Engineering principles, theories and concepts. Mechanical background/abilities would be a plus. Some variation in work shifts may be necessary in the future. On occasion travel may be required. Candidate must be able to qualify for and maintain a Secret Security Clearance.
